"The White Cot For Me"
Pale she lay in a cot, dreaming a new day.

Strapped in the baby seat
dressed in a woven shawl;
a bird in the cage to coo
why do you love me?

A nurse holding my arm
a needle in me to sleep
dreaming away the fear,
where are my parents?

Dad’s tears in his eyes
trying to fake a smile
from the pain within
helping to hold me,

then falling on the floor
gasping out for breath
seeing me in the cot
pale and afraid to die.

I wake the morning
waiting all alone,
too tiny to cry
why all the tears

when I can see -
Angels in the sky
singing to Jesus
waving a smile.

Dad and mom
their Christmas tree
with ornaments,
healing presents for me,

living in a family room
through heaven's door,
dressed in silk pajamas
a white cot there for me.
